Annual CFF:
-$258.54M+$60.46M(+18.95%)Summary
- As of today, STM annual cash from financing is -$258.54 million, with the most recent change of +$60.46 million (+18.95%) on December 31, 2024.
- During the last 3 years, STM annual cash from financing has risen by +$1.11 billion (+81.11%).
- STM annual cash from financing is now -116.00% below its all-time high of $1.62 billion, reached on December 31, 2000.

Cash From Financing Formula
CFF = Cash Inflows from Financing Activities − Cash Outflows from Financing Activities
